Pronunciation: /ˈdaʊnlɪŋk/
noun
Etymology: Etymology tree English down- English link English downlink From down- + link.
- The transmission of a signal from a satellite to a receiving station on earth; or the means of this transmission.
- The transmission of data from a network, usually wireless, to the user.
